Buynomics is the next-generation SaaS company in pricing and product optimization. It employs large-scale simulation technologies to digitize customers and predict their purchasing behavior in any environment. Our clients use Buynomics to make data-driven decisions about their current and new products, overall portfolio structure, pricing, promotions, trade terms, and more, 100x faster and more precisely than every other solution. 

We aim to enable companies to make data-driven, transparent, and customer-centric commercial decisions. For that, we build the operating system for commercial decisions that provides companies with a single source of truth to answer all their market-facing questions, including pricing, product offers, and promotions.

What you'll do: 

You will lead a team of currently four Business Development Representatives (BDRs) and carry a personal outbound quota. This is a player-coach position; roughly 75% of your time goes to managing and developing the US-based BDR team, and the other 25% to working towards your personal target.

You set the standard for our US BDRs, build the BDR playbook for the Americas, and ensure the team meets quotas.

Team Management:

  • Coach the US-based BDRs on handling inbound leads, outbound prospecting, sequencing, and qualifying enterprise opportunities in the Americas.
  • Run weekly 1:1s, team meetings, and regular calling sessions
  • Develop and refine the US outbound playbook (sequencing, messaging, target account lists, and qualification criteria) in close collaboration with the VP of Sales.
  • Hold the team accountable for meeting quality standards and qualified meeting goals. Report performance clearly and without excuses.

Personal Pipeline:

  • Manage an individual outbound target aimed at executive commercial leaders within the CPG, Retail, and Telecommunications sectors.
  • Execute strategic, multi-channel outreach to engage complex buying groups, prioritizing meaningful dialogue over sheer outreach volume.
  • Transition thoroughly vetted leads to Account Executives using the MEDDIC framework, ensuring deep visibility into stakeholder needs and pain points.
  • Act as a brand ambassador for Buynomics at US industry gatherings, fostering relationships within the Pricing and RGM professional circles.

What we're looking for: 

Must Haves:

  • 3+ years in a BDR or outbound sales role at an enterprise B2B SaaS or data/analytics company, with at least 1 year in a lead capacity. You have developed people, not just performed alongside them.
  • Proven outbound track record into enterprise accounts. You have opened doors at large companies using structured, multi-touch prospecting, not just inbound sales.
  • Comfortable selling a technical, analytical product to senior business buyers.
  • Structured thinker. You run sequenced processes, document your team's numbers, and can give an honest read of what’s working and what’s not.

Strong Advantage:

  • Background in (selling to) CPGs and/or working with pricing tools, revenue growth management software, or commercial analytics platforms (e.g. NielsenIQ, Kantar, Circana, Pricing SaaS).
  • Existing network within CPG, Retail, or Telco in the Americas.
  • Familiarity with MEDDIC or similar structured qualification methodology.
  • Experience building or iterating a BDR sales playbook in a scaling startup.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
